WristNav Offline GPX Maps: Standalone Navigation for Wear OS
If you've been looking for a proper navigation app on your Wear OS watch that doesn't rely on your phone, I've been building one called WristNav and it's free on the Play Store.
WHAT IT DOES
Turn-by-turn navigation on your wrist, completely standalone.
Download offline OSM maps directly to the watch no phone, no data connection needed. Contours are currently shown if you build your own maps — I'm working on adding contour lines to the official map files too. Import GPX routes and follow them with live turn arrows, distance to next turn, and haptic alerts when a turn is approaching. There's a live elevation profile on the map as you navigate, and bezel stats let you configure up to 3 stats that show around the edge of the map screen.
ACTIVITY TRACKING
10 activity types — Run, Trail Run, Walk, Hike, Road Cycle, MTB, Gravel, Kayak, Ski, Snowboard. Up to 10 custom stats pages, fully configurable. Auto-pause, lap splits, countdown timer, heart rate and step recording. A workout summary automatically appears when you stop.
PHONE COMPANION
There's a companion Android app too, with a 3D mapping view for planning routes — build a route, send it straight to the watch, or save it to a file for later.
CUSTOMISATION
5 watch themes, 7 map themes including minimal variants and custom theme support. Quick Settings lets you swipe left from home to access your most used settings instantly — fully customisable so you only see what you need. Battery Saver mode switches to a dark minimal map and disables sensors in one tap, then restores everything when you turn it off.

A NOTE ON STRAVA
WristNav currently supports uploading activities to Strava. Heads up that this may not stick around — Strava's changes to their developer program have introduced subscription costs, and depending on how that shakes out I may end up having to drop the integration.
